Troubleshooting Steps

To recover your Samsung Notes app, follow these troubleshooting steps:
First, check if the app is still installed on your device. Go to the Google Play Store or the Samsung Galaxy Store and search for “Samsung Notes.” If the app is not installed, you can download and install it from the store.
If the app is installed but not visible on your home screen, try checking the app drawer or the list of installed apps on your device.
If the App is disabled, go to Settings > Apps > Samsung Notes and enable it.
If the app is still not working, try clearing the app’s cache and data. Go to Settings > Apps > Samsung Notes > Storage > Clear Cache and Clear Data.

Using Safe Mode to Troubleshoot

Safe Mode is A diagnostic mode that allows you to troubleshoot issues with your device. To use Safe Mode to troubleshoot the Samsung Notes app, follow these steps:
Restart your device and press the volume down button as it boots up.
Release the volume down button when you see the Safe Mode screen.
Try using the Samsung Notes app in Safe Mode to see if it works properly.
If the app works in Safe Mode, it may indicate that a third-party app is causing the issue.

Why has my Samsung Notes app disappeared from my device?

The Samsung Notes app is a default application on Samsung devices, and it’s unlikely to completely disappear. However, it’s possible that the app icon has been removed from the home screen or the app has been disabled. To check if the app is still installed on your device, go to the Settings app, select “Apps,” and look for Samsung Notes in the list of installed applications. If you find it, you can enable it and add the icon back to your home screen.

If you’re unable to find the Samsung Notes app in the Settings menu, it’s possible that the app has been uninstalled or is no longer compatible with your device. In this case, you can try reinstalling the app from the Google Play Store or the Samsung Galaxy Store. Make sure to check the compatibility of the app with your device before reinstalling. Additionally, if you have a Samsung account, you can try syncing your device with your account to restore the app. If none of these steps work, you may need to perform a factory reset on your device, but be sure to back up your data before doing so.

How do I reset the Samsung Notes app to its default settings?

If you’re experiencing issues with the Samsung Notes app and want to start from scratch, you can reset the app to its default settings. To do this, go to the Settings app on your device, select “Apps,” and choose Samsung Notes from the list of installed applications. From there, select “Storage” and then “Clear data” and “Clear cache.” This will remove all of your notes and settings, so be sure to back up your data before taking this step.

After resetting the Samsung Notes app, you’ll need to set it up again from scratch. This includes signing in to your Samsung account, setting up any desired features or settings, and recreating any lost notes. How do I back up my Samsung Notes data to prevent loss?

To back up your Samsung Notes data, you can use the Samsung Cloud service, which automatically syncs your notes with your Samsung account. To enable Samsung Cloud, go to the Settings app on your device, select “Accounts and backup,” and then “Samsung Cloud.” From there, make sure that the “Samsung Notes” option is enabled. You can also back up your notes manually by exporting them as a file or syncing them with a third-party cloud storage service.

In addition to using Samsung Cloud, you can also back up your Samsung Notes data to a computer or other device using a USB cable or wireless transfer method. To do this, connect your device to your computer, open the Samsung Notes app, and select the notes you want to back up. You can then export the notes as a file or sync them with a cloud storage service.
